My great great grandfather Karl Reiner came over to UK from Germany around 1835 and was appointed as a tutor to one of Queen Victioria's children. However the only person he ever told about his origins was Queen Victoria herself. Does anyone have experience of tracing ancestors in Germany and what resources are available?

Just a note from rootsweb: Message Boards.

There is a message for the Reiner family - although it goes back to 2006 - lists below some names: It is connected through Central Europe - Germany, etc.

Here is a brief of the names selected: There are some recommendations. I am not sure if this is where you wish to go back to as you have the British connection, but this may just help.

Re: Reiner or Reiners or Reinert

Posted: 18 Aug 2006 4:11AM GMT
Classification: Query
Surnames: Reiner, Reiners, Reinert

in Germany you lease a grave for 20 or 25 or 30 years (it varies from place to place), there are almost never really old graves.

You better have a look at emigrant lists such as
http://www.la-bw.de/auswanderer
